Sheetz Named Top Convenience Store Brand Of The Year

Sheetz has been recognized as consumers’ most-trusted convenience store brand, according to the 2015 Harris Poll EquiTrend study. For the first time, Sheetz, a family-owned and operated convenience chain based in Altoona, Pennsylvania, received the highest Equity Score among the other convenience store retailers. Couche-Tard To Acquire 21 Stores, 151 Dealer Sites In Southwest

Alimentation Couche-Tard has signed, through its wholly-owned indirect subsidiary Circle K Stores, an agreement with Cinco J, (doing business as Johnson Oil Co.), Tiger Tote Food Stores and their affiliates to acquire 21 stores, 151 dealer fuel supply agreements and five development properties. New Resource Builds The Business Case For Produce Sales At C-Stores

A primer to help convenience stores sell more produce was published Monday by the National Association of Convenience Stores (NACS) and the United Fresh Produce Association. “Building the Business Case for Produce Sales at Convenience Stores” combines analysis of industry and consumer trends with practical ideas to develop an enhanced produce offering in stores. AWMA Changes Its Name To Convenience Distribution Association

The American Wholesale Marketers Association has changed its name to the Convenience Distribution Association (CDA). The big announcement was made at the 2015 AWMA Marketplace & Solutions Expo in Las Vegas.
